Choosing the appropriate material for construction is an essential step in any building process. This decision can greatly affect the outcome of your project. When deciding on materials, factors such as cost, durability, and the project’s environmental impact should be considered.
Price is often the first thing that comes to mind when choosing construction materials. Yet, it’s crucial to note that the cheapest materials may not always be the best in terms of quality and durability. Instead, consider the lifespan of each material, as well as any maintenance or repair costs that may arise in the future. Long-lasting and low-maintenance materials may cost more upfront, but they can save money in the long run.
Durability is another crucial factor to consider when choosing construction materials. Materials should be able to withstand the local climate and the wear and tear of everyday use. For instance, wood is a popular choice for many construction projects due to its aesthetic appeal and versatility. However, it may not be the best choice in areas prone to termites or heavy rainfall. In these cases, other materials such as brick or concrete might be more suitable.
The environmental impact of construction materials is a rising issue in today’s society. Therefore, a lot of contractors are on the hunt for sustainable and environmentally-friendly materials. These include recycled materials, locally-sourced materials, and materials that contribute to energy efficiency. By choosing these materials, you are not only reducing your project’s environmental footprint but also contributing to a more sustainable future.
Lastly, the aesthetic appeal of the materials should be considered. After all, the elements you choose will define the look and feel of your project. Whether you prefer a modern, industrial look with metal and glass, or a more traditional style with brick and wood, make sure your materials will achieve the desired aesthetic.
In conclusion, choosing the right construction materials involves more than just picking the cheapest option. It requires careful consideration of factors such as cost, durability, environmental impact, and aesthetics. By keeping these factors in mind, you can ensure that your construction project will be successful, durable, and aesthetically pleasing.
